AdMeter logo AdMeter

AdMeter is a cloud-based analytical platform that allows you to improve your marketing strategies by using accurate analytical reports and also understanding the behavior of your targeted customers.

Programming Hub logo Programming Hub

The best app to learn 14+ programming languages such as Python, Assembly, HTML, VB.

Programming Hub features and specs

  • Comprehensive Course Library
    Programming Hub offers a wide variety of courses covering multiple programming languages and technologies, allowing users to learn and explore various coding topics in one place.
  • Interactive Learning
    The platform provides an interactive learning experience with hands-on coding exercises and quizzes, which helps users to reinforce their understanding of programming concepts.
  • Mobile Accessibility
    Programming Hub is available as a mobile app, making it convenient for users to learn and practice coding on the go using their smartphones.
  • Gamified Learning
    The platform includes gamified elements such as achievements and rewards, which motivate users to stay engaged and complete their courses.
  • Certificates of Completion
    Users can earn certificates upon completing courses, which can be useful for showcasing their skills to potential employers or adding to their professional profiles.

Possible disadvantages of Programming Hub

  • Limited Deep-Dive Content
    While Programming Hub offers a broad range of courses, some users may find that the depth of content in advanced topics is limited compared to more specialized platforms.
  • Subscription Cost
    Access to premium features and courses on Programming Hub requires a paid subscription, which may not be affordable for all users.
  • Lack of Personalization
    The learning path is not highly personalized, which may make it difficult for users with specific learning goals to find a tailored roadmap.
  • No Peer Interaction
    The platform lacks features for peer-to-peer interaction and collaboration, which can be beneficial for learning through discussions and group projects.
  • Variable Content Quality
    The quality of course material can vary, with some users reporting that certain courses or explanations are not as thorough or clear as others.

20 Best Scratch Alternatives 2023
While Scratch is popular among desktop users, Programming Hub targets mobile users. As a result, the platform only features mobile applications for Android and iOS. It doesnโ€™t have a desktop app, and you canโ€™t use it online.
